Moldova's parliament approves defense strategy, calls for increased defense spending

Moldova's parliament, controlled by pro-Western lawmakers, approved a 10-year defense strategy on Thursday that calls for increased defense spending as part of a plan to join the European Union. Pro-Russian opponents in the parliament scoffed that the document was pointlessly aimed directly at Moscow, despite Moldova's small size and small armed forces.

South Korean prosecutors have launched their first investigation into former lawmaker Kim Nam-guk over alleged cryptocurrency mis-trading

According to Yonhap News Agency, South Korean prosecutors have launched their first investigation into former lawmaker Kim Nam-kook for possible illegal cryptocurrency transactions during his tenure as a lawmaker. Previously, it was reported that former lawmaker Kim Nanguo held virtual currencies worth up to 6 billion won (about 4.48 million US dollars) such as Wemix coin, Mabrex, Bora, etc., which aroused public suspicion about the source of his investment funds and the use of funds.

Nigerian government: Jailed Binance executives have access to quality medical care

In recent weeks, U.S. lawmakers have called attention to the Nigerian government's treatment of detained Binance executive Tigran Gambaryan, who has been detained by the Nigerian government since February on charges of money laundering and tax evasion. Although the tax evasion charges were dropped earlier this month, Gambaryan remains in custody pending another case.
